A Call for Literature Evangelists

The Publishing Director of the General Conference of the Seventh-day Adventist Church, Dr. Howard Faigao, and the Northern Asia-Pacific Division (NSD) Publishing Director, Dr.Teru Fukui, came to Mongolia on August 14 and 15, 2012. They met with the Administration officers, Church Pastors and Church Leaders of the Mongolia Mission Field (MMF) concerning its drive to promote the publishing ministryworldwide through the active participation of literature evangelists. In Pastor Faigao’s presentation, emphasis was given on the importance of having a sense of mission and vision,as well as strong leadership. He also discussed formulation of publishing policies that will address in part the remuneration and benefits of the colporteurs, and having a  quality product- the printed books – which are worthy for selling and sharing.

During the consultation process in the Publishing Committee of MMF, it was agreed that the latter will create Mongolia Adventist Publishing Association. In doing so, each Church is to be represented by at least one literature evangelist. Administrators, on the other hand, committed to intensify the promotion in all areas of the Publishing ministry program and to enhance the accountability of existing books, sales proceeds, and the overall operation of the Publishing Association. Testimonies for the Church 8:89 states, “the printing and circulation of books and papers that contain the truth for this time are to be our work”. MMF surely embraces the commitment to bring people to Christ through literature ministry.
